In La Liga action, Barcelona met Elche on November 2. Barcelona emerged victorious with a 3-1 win.
Lamine Yamal scored the first goal of the game on the 9th minute of the match, giving Barcelona the lead. Ferran Torres, Rafa Mir and Marcus Rashford added to the score, setting the final scoreline at 3-1.

Barcelona kicked off the game with Wojciech Szczesny, Alejandro Balde who got substituted by Gerard Martin on the 74th minute, Eric Garcia, Ronald Araujo, Jules Kounde, Fermin Lopez who got substituted by Dani Olmo on the 66th minute, Marc Casado Torras, Frenkie de Jong, Marcus Rashford who got substituted by Robert Lewandowski on the 74th minute, Ferran Torres who got substituted by Dro Fernandez on the 88th minute and Lamine Yamal who got substituted by Roony Bardghji on the 88th minute as starters, with Diego Kochen, Eder Aller, Pau Cubarsi, Gerard Martin, Xavi Espart, Dro Fernandez, Marc Bernal, Roony Bardghji, Dani Olmo and Robert Lewandowski on the bench.
Elche's starting eleven were Inaki Pena, Alvaro Nunez, Pedro Bigas who got substituted by Hector Fort on the 70th minute, David Affengruber, Adria Pedrosa who got substituted by John Donald on the 82nd minute, Marc Aguado, Rafa Mir, Aleix Febas, Martim Neto who got substituted by Rodrigo Mendoza Martinez Moya on the 46th minute, German Valera who got substituted by Yago Santiago on the 70th minute and Andre Silva who got substituted by Alvaro Rodriguez on the 74th minute, with Matias Dituro, Leo Petrot, John Donald, Victor Chust, Hector Fort, Rodrigo Mendoza Martinez Moya, Federico Redondo, Yago Santiago, Josan, Grady Diangana, Alvaro Rodriguez and Adam Boayar Benaisa on the bench.

Referee showed the yellow card once throughout the game. Martim Neto was the one to receive it.
Since February 2021, the teams have gone head-to-head five times. Every match has gone Barcelona's way, as they have won all five encounters. The most recent match between them was on April 1, 2023, in La Liga of Spain, where Barcelona secured a 0-4 victory. Barcelona have scored fifteen goals across these five encounters, while Elche have scored three. So far, Barcelona have proven stronger in their recent head-to-head record against Elche.
In La Liga, Barcelona have played ten matches, winning seven, drawing one and losing two, scoring 25 goals at an average of 2.50 per match and conceding twelve at a rate of 1.20 per match. Elche have won three of their ten matches in La Liga this season, with five draws and two defeats, scoring eleven goals, averaging 1.10 per match, while conceding ten, an average of 1.00 per match.
Barcelona's most recent outing ended in a loss against Real Madrid, while Elche are coming off a win in their last match against Los Garres. Overall, Barcelona have won fourteen of their last twenty matches, losing four and drawing two, while Elche have won eight of their last twenty matches, losing seven and drawing five.
As always, Spain La Liga's live standings are availble and updated in real time. Barcelona sit 3rd with 22 points from ten matches, while Elche are currently 8th in the table with fourteen points from ten matches.
